The Cost of Double Pane Insulated Windows An In-Depth Analysis


When it comes to home improvement and energy efficiency, one of the most significant investments homeowners can make is upgrading to double pane insulated windows. The benefits of these windows are well-documented, including improved energy efficiency, noise reduction, and enhanced comfort. However, understanding the cost associated with double pane insulated windows is crucial for making an informed decision.


What Are Double Pane Insulated Windows?


Double pane insulated windows consist of two panes of glass separated by a spacer and filled with an insulating gas, such as argon or krypton. This design helps to reduce heat transfer, keeping your home warmer in the winter and cooler in the summer. Additionally, double pane windows can significantly lower energy bills due to their enhanced insulating properties.


Average Costs


The cost of double pane insulated windows can vary widely depending on factors like material, size, brand, and installation. On average, homeowners can expect to pay between $300 to $1,000 per window, including installation.


1. Material Costs The type of frame material plays a significant role in the overall cost. Vinyl frames tend to be the most affordable, averaging around $300 to $600 per window. Wood frames, while aesthetically pleasing and energy-efficient, can cost between $800 and $1,200. Aluminum frames typically fall somewhere in between.


2. Glass Type The type of glass used can also influence the price. Standard double pane glass is the least expensive option. However, homeowners may choose low-E (low emissivity) glass, which can cost more but provides additional energy savings by reflecting heat back into the home.


3. Size and Style The size and style of the windows will also affect the price. Standard sizes are less expensive, while custom sizes or architectural shapes can increase the cost significantly. Additionally, features such as grids or decorative glass can add to the overall price.

4. Installation Costs Hiring a professional for installation is generally recommended to ensure proper sealing and energy efficiency. Installation costs typically range from $100 to $300 per window, depending on the complexity of the installation and regional labor rates.


Long-Term Savings


While the initial investment in double pane insulated windows may seem steep, the long-term savings on energy bills can be substantial. Studies have shown that replacement windows can reduce heating and cooling costs by 10% to 25%, depending on the home's location and insulation.


Moreover, many utility companies offer rebates and incentives for upgrading to energy-efficient windows, further offsetting the initial costs. Additionally, the increased comfort and reduced noise pollution are often cited as significant advantages by homeowners.


Additional Considerations


When budgeting for double pane insulated windows, homeowners should also consider the potential increase in property value. An energy-efficient home is increasingly attractive to buyers, and new windows can enhance curb appeal.


It’s also essential to compare quotes from multiple contractors to find the best pricing and quality of service. Investing in reputable brands and certified installers may lead to better energy performance and longevity of the windows.
